Differential immune response in two handled inbred strains of mice

Abstract:
C57BL/10J and BALB/cJ mice, outfostered at birth to C3H/2Ibg dams were subjected to handling on days 1 through 20 of life. Their plaque forming cell (PFC) response to sheep red blood cells as adults on day 5 post-immunization was compared to the PFC response in non-handled control mice. The PFC response of handled C57BL/10J mice was significantly suppressed compared to the PFC response in non-handled mice while the response of the handled and non-handled BALB/cJ mice was not significantly different.
